Even the brave are scared off by the idea of interior decorating. The fact of the matter is, however, that good interior design is something that can be achieved by anyone who takes the time to learn some fundamental concepts and tricks. Use these tips to get amazing results. Decide on a mood for a room or space before beginning to actually work on designing the space. Moods can range from outrageous and exciting to soothing and calm. Selecting a mood you like prior to beginning will help you make the decisions as you plan for the space creating a cohesive feel when complete. Keep in mind the usage of the room space when you are planning a design. If it is a kids room you are decorating, you want want brighter colors that will match their bubbly personality. However, those hues would not be good choices for a study or library, for example. Picking the right colors is essential for every design project. You should think about what looks good together and what will not so your room looks balanced. Avoid using a lot of bold colors in a single room. Good art pieces can go along way in interior design. You may not value art at all, but just one painting can set the tone for the whole room. A painting could also serve as a starting point in which you could start decorating other things. A good suggestion for interior design is to be aware of the lighting level within a room. If a room doesn't have that many windows, you might want to go with a lighter shade of paint or wallpaper so that the room doesn't seem like a cave. When you are putting together a home office make the most use of the space you have. A comfortable workspace and proper lighting is crucial. Even though the space needs to be one conducive to working, it should also be visually pleasing. Be aware that there's a risk of cluttering up a room with excess furnishings when you get into an ambitious interior design job. Having too much accessories or furniture in your room can make it look cluttered and smaller than what it actually is. This is why you should just choose a few furniture pieces that you need in order to create lots of space. Keep your interior decorating costs down by searching for discount versions of designer items. It is not always necessary to pay designer prices for the high end designer look. In the end go with the cheapest price available so you can save a lot of money. Use area rugs on cold types of flooring. Remember to rotate your rugs frequently so that the rug will wear evenly. Quick spins or changing the spot can help your rugs continue to look new for a longer period of time. Many people have opinions with regards to interior planning, but you shouldn't listen to all of it. You won't get the home of your dreams until you trust yourself and devise an interior design strategy that is reflective of your own personality. It is important that any room has sufficient lighting. It determines the mood. Kitchen and bathrooms require adequate lighting in order to function properly. So try to find a balance between bright lighting and dark colors to compliment them. Bedrooms require a dimmer lighting structure. Replacing your kitchen cabinets can be a cost effective and easy way to drastically change the look of your kitchen. Try using glass doors instead of traditional wood doors to open up your kitchen and make it look brighter. You could also place some accent pieces in the cabinets to add some extra appeal to your kitchen. It is a good idea to use popular elements in your design. They can give a room a stylish and modern feel. You do want to remember, though, that too much of something can be a bad thing. If a zebra-print pillow goes out of style, it is easy to replace it. A love-seat with a similar style will be a bit more difficult for you. Keep your style top of mind when planning any room. While it should appear nice for company, you'll be living in it. If you want some crazy decor or frilly pillows to cover your beds and sofas, then do it, as you're the one who needs to be happy with the living space. If you do not like the look later down the line, you can make it different. Whenever you are painting one of your rooms, be creative. You can find all sorts of creative design videos online for inspiration. Using creative methods to paint your walls can really make a difference.
